The Technology Behind the
National Animal Identification System By Judith McGeary -
August 2006
- The government's proposed National Animal Identification System
("NAIS") poses numerous problems: massive government intrusion into
our lives, unnecessary and burdensome costs, the lack of a real need
for such a program, and the fact that tracking does not solve disease
issues. Looking more closely just at the last issue, the USDA's
disease control claims rely on the assumption that nationwide tracking
is even possible. In truth, the technology is flawed in many ways,
ranging from problems with the microchips to problems with the
databases.
